The conventiion is certainly not going to help, neither is your Friday night.

IMHO:

Book a cancellable backup and then wait until about 1 week before the trip to bid for hopefully inventory that the hotels have released due to undercapacity for the convention.

Also I think the Friday night could be a problem as this will probably require a higher bid than the Wed\Thurs if\when inventory becomes available.

If you want to try for a 5* on Priceline i would bid up to $140, but keep in mind that after their fee you're probably looking at only about a $25 savings per nite and you'll likely have to change hotels for the last nite, so not sure if success at $140 (or anything about $120) would really be worth it do to the hotel change (as we're talking about two very nice hotels)... but it's up to you what you prefer and how much you view changing properties as an inconvenience.
